I used to go to this pub every weekend for 6 years (I used to go out with someone who lived locally).
I must say this is a beautiful lovely small pub with a real Victorian decor with some fresh flower arrangement on the mantelpiece and hand pumped beers - I don't drink beer so cannot tell, but apparently this makes a lot of difference to the taste.
People who gather there are rather posh-ish but very friendly. No shouting trakkies.
A perfect place to go to to have a quiet drink with weekend papers. Miss this place.

the swimmers is a very nice cosy little pub, and on top of all is fairly quiet and quite hidden. The food is nicer than the usual pub food, slightly more up-market; selection is better and amount is good. The seating arrangement however makes the pub tight at some bits n finding room can be a drag, but good in the summer with the outdoor seating arrangement. Nice friendly atmosphere too!
